Abstract

A solid state electrochemical cell, Na0.75CoO2/sodium beta-alumina/metal grid, is presented which is capable of producing a beam of sodium vapour in UHV. Cells such as these have potential applications as a source of dopants in semiconductor fabrication. Electrochemical measurements and a new spectroelectrochemical technique provide mechanistic information regarding sodium electro-generation.
